以太坊是目前最受欢迎的区块链平台之一,它不仅支持智能合约的开发与执行,还提供了去中心化应用(DApps)的开发环境。尽管以太坊在技术上非常先进,但其转账速度却成为了一个普遍的问题。在以太坊网络上进行转账时,用户常常会遇到交易延迟和拥堵的情况,这给用户的使用体验带来了一定的困扰。
背景信息
以太坊是基于区块链技术的开源平台,它的主要目标是为去中心化应用提供一个可靠的环境。以太坊的核心是以太币(Ether),它是以太坊网络中的数字货币,用于支付交易费用和奖励矿工。由于以太坊的交易处理速度相对较慢,导致交易延迟和网络拥堵成为了一个常见的问题。
以太坊转账速度慢的原因
以太坊转账速度慢的问题主要有以下几个原因:
1. 区块链的共识机制:以太坊使用的是工作量证明(Proof of Work)的共识机制,这意味着在进行转账时,需要等待矿工完成挖矿并打包交易。由于矿工的数量有限,而交易的数量却很大,导致交易的确认时间较长。
2. Gas价格设置不合理:以太坊的转账费用是由用户设置的Gas价格决定的,而有些用户为了尽快确认交易,设置了过高的Gas价格,导致其他用户的交易被延迟。这种情况下,转账速度会受到影响。
3. 网络拥堵:随着以太坊的普及,网络上的交易数量不断增加,导致网络拥堵的情况越来越严重。当网络拥堵时,交易的确认时间会变得更长。
解决以太坊转账慢的方法
为了解决以太坊转账慢的问题,可以采取以下几种方法:
1. 提高区块大小:增加以太坊区块的大小可以提高每个区块中可以包含的交易数量,从而加快交易的确认速度。增加区块大小也会增加区块链的存储需求和网络带宽的消耗,需要权衡利弊。
2. 改进共识机制:以太坊正在计划升级到Proof of Stake(PoS)共识机制,这将大大提高交易的处理速度。PoS机制不再需要矿工进行挖矿,而是通过持有一定数量的以太币来参与网络的验证和确认,从而减少了交易的延迟。
3. 优化Gas价格设置:以太坊可以通过优化Gas价格设置来减少交易延迟。用户可以根据当前网络情况和自身需求合理设置Gas价格,避免设置过高或过低的情况。
4. 使用Layer 2解决方案:Layer 2是一种在以太坊上构建的第二层扩展方案,它可以将大量的交易从主链上移除,从而减少了主链的负载。常见的Layer 2解决方案包括状态通道、侧链和Rollups等。
以太坊转账慢是一个普遍存在的问题,但随着以太坊技术的不断发展和改进,这个问题有望得到解决。通过提高区块大小、改进共识机制、优化Gas价格设置以及使用Layer 2解决方案,可以显著提高以太坊的转账速度,提升用户的使用体验。随着区块链技术的普及和应用场景的不断扩大,我们有理由相信以太坊的转账速度将会变得更快、更可靠。